Event Management has two basic segments. Logistics management, which involves organising the venue, celebrities, umpires, spectators, promotions, etc. and marketing, which requires getting sponsorships for event and promoting the event through various media. The post graduate course is for a period of one year. The course is divided into two semesters of five papers each. The first semester deals with event marketing, public relations and sponsorship, event coordination, event planning (which includes training students in organising fashion shows, weddings, corporate events, sporting events and exhibitions) and practical training. The second semester includes theoretical and practical training in event team relationship, laws pertaining to Event Management, event accounting and logistics. As part of the practical training, students also get the chance to work for mega events like film award functions, fashion shows, jewellery exhibition and corporate events.

There are some institutions like Indian Institute of Event Management which is also offer Diploma in Event Management for undergraduates with the same curriculam and same duration as that for postgraduate course. There are other courses as well which are part time courses (six months) and crash course (part time).

With the concept of Event Management getting increasingly popular even in smaller towns, the demand for professionals has increased. For a trained person, this is a goldmine, both in terms of business opportunity as well as future prospects. Be it in the field of client servicing, ideation, creativity or simply technical production, the exciting aspect is that whatever you do in the area of Event Management is visible to all and top-of-the-mind. The challenge is to do the job brilliantly, with the reward being pure appreciation which is instantaneous. This makes you feel euphoric and the feeling goes beyond mere money and material benefits.

One can comfortably earn anything between Rs. 8,000-15,000 per month by working as an Event Manager in a company and can comfortably earn Rs. 30,000 and above per month as a small-time Event Manager.

However, you should know that it's not a bed of roses. The Event Management also requires a lot of drudgery and leg-work even while you rub shoulders with superstars and jet from city to city. Staying up on your third consecutive nights, yelling at contractors, or dealing politely with the Press as you try and manage a hundred things simultaneously, are a part of your responsibility.

With events now being recognised as a new medium of communication and the front runners in this field starting to take a financial interest in this sector, the new medium serves as a challenge both to the communicator as well as the audience.
